  • Title

    Balanced Multiphase High Frequency Micro-Distribution Power Bus for electric vehicles (BM-HFMDB)

  • Abstract
    A Balanced Multiphase High-Frequency Micro-Distribution Bus (BM-HFMDB) for electric vehicles (EV) has the same copper (e.g., wire) utilization as the traditional DC bus but provides convenient compatibility with the major power consuming components of an EV, such as regenerative variable frequency AC electric motor or generator systems, but with fewer electronic stages for direct DC or AC conversion and without DC Link stages that always include bulky, inefficient, and expensive reactive components. Unlike all previously proposed multiphase high frequency distribution buses with replicated circuit topologies of simple isolated single phase or DC high frequency buses that were proven to be uneconomical, the BM-HFMDB economically and safely provides bi-directional multiphase power at any voltage, frequency and phase by appropriately modulating the power to the phase windings of a position-dependent-flux high frequency transformer (PDF-HFT) with simple choppers for sharing the common flux energy between phase windings.
